Meun is living in Moung Reussey district of Battambang province, 37 years old and married. She is a mother of three dependent children, two of whom are in school and the other one is too young. Nowadays, Meun is rice farming and her husband is climbing the palm trees to get extra income. Together, they are able to earn income just enough to support their family’s situation.
Because of the growing season and Meun is short of working capital, she decided to apply for a loan with VisionFund. For Meun, this is her seventh microloan cycle with VisionFund and she has paid her past loans on time.
She could provide her family with decent household supplies for using in her house via the previous loans. In a group of three members, she is the group leader. Meun is planning to manage her loan portion to buy fertilizer, seed and pay for labor fees to improve her farming business. Meun expects to increase more yields and get more profit in order to upgrade her living condition and support her children’s studying on time.
